    My chiller states that my current tank temp is 82 degrees... my digital thermometer in the tank says 78.0....

    Hmm which one is most accurate???


    Is the chiller faulty maybe??

    Never rely on only 1 temp probe. I alway keep a old mercury type one around just in case I think something is wrong. Most Chillers have adjustment to compensate for temp difference.
